1. Facility Resilience and Production Status

Following a tornado that struck the manufacturing facility on a Friday, the plant sustained damage to the south end, including the loss of the roof and structural impacts to the logistics area.

  • Operational Response: Despite the damage, the team successfully maintained production, with vehicles continuing to roll off the line by the following Monday.
  • Logistics Adjustments: While the physical flow of materials through dock doors was disrupted, the company implemented workarounds to ensure the ramp-up strategy remains unchanged.
  • Quote: RJ Scaringe described the recovery as "the ultimate example of resilience of the business."

2. R2 Product Strategy and Market Positioning

The R2 is designed to compete in the mass-market segment, targeting the average U.S. new car price of approximately $50,000.

  • Pricing Structure: The lineup will range from a $45,000 base model to a $57,000 performance variant.
  • Launch Strategy: Rivian is prioritizing the premium/top-spec version for the initial launch, with mid-spec and base-spec models to follow over the subsequent year.
  • Design Evolution: The R2 incorporates significant learnings from the R1 platform, specifically regarding cost efficiency, power electronics, and drive-line architecture.

3. Autonomous Driving and Technical Infrastructure

Rivian is advancing its self-driving capabilities through a combination of hardware and software integration.

  • Compute Stack: The vehicle utilizes in-house silicon, featuring two 800 TOPS (Tera Operations Per Second) chips, paired with a sensor suite of cameras, radar, and roof-mounted LiDAR.
  • Capability Roadmap:
    • Level 2: Point-to-point navigation (hands-off, eyes-on) rolling out later this year for Gen 2 R1 and R2.
    • Level 3: Hands-off, eyes-off capability for specific domains (e.g., highways) scheduled for next year.
  • Data Flywheel: The high-volume R2 fleet is critical for training the company’s "large driving model." The inclusion of LiDAR and enhanced inference hardware in specific variants allows for superior data collection to improve autonomous performance.

4. Business Model and Software Licensing

Rivian is positioning itself as both a vehicle manufacturer and a technology provider.

  • Revenue Diversification: Beyond vehicle sales, the company is aggressively pursuing software licensing.
  • Volkswagen Partnership: A $5.8 billion deal was established to license Rivian’s compute stack and operating system (OS) across the Volkswagen vehicle portfolio.
  • Future Outlook: Scaringe indicated that the company is open to further licensing deals, including potential future autonomy stacks, as a long-term revenue pillar.
